## Runbook: Rounding Errors in Pellwick Currency Conversion

If reconciliation flags sub-cent discrepancies, the cause is almost always a mismatch between the converter's rounding mode and the ledger's. Pellwick rounds at conversion time, half-even, four decimal places internally. Do not patch totals by hand; fix the config and rerun the batch. The converter currently runs with these settings.

service settings:
HOLDOR_PIN=6477
HOLDOR_METRICS_HOST=metrics.holdor.nelvrocorp.corp
HOLDOR_LOG_LEVEL=error
HOLDOR_TENANT=noviel

Handover — Recording Studio, Brindlemoor Annex

Mira, the Quillfort training-video studio is yours while I'm out. Contractors from Ostrel Media arrive Tuesday; they know the kit but not the building. Lights and cameras stay patched as-is. Remind them to sign the studio log and power down the mixer at day's end. The side door keypad accepts the contractor code, listed below.

staff pass of kawip-hawef = bdg-QLP-2

- [ ] Step 7: Archive cold storage buckets (Glacierline tier). Confirm both ceremony witnesses are present, verify bucket manifests match the Oxbow ledger, then seal the archive key shares. Plugin authors may observe but not handle shares. Once sealed, the archive index itself is encrypted and can only be reopened with the passphrase below.

vault phrase of badup-hahig = tamael-aldael-kelmir-istael-fenok-istwyn-tamius-jorath-oliion

Welcome to on-call for the Glimmerpane design system! Our snapshot tests live in the `snapcheck` suite and run on every merge to main. If a UI component changes visually, the diff bot flags it — usually it's an intentional tweak, so just approve the new baseline. If it's 2am and snapshots are failing across the board, it's almost always a font-loading race, not your problem. To unlock the baseline store and re-approve snapshots in bulk, use the recovery passphrase below.

recovery phrase for tahag-taguf: wenix-caswyn